What Is The Average Cost For Travertine Cleaning in Wardhedges?

Grasping the average cost of Travertine cleaning is essential for successful budget management of your restoration project.

Typically, you can expect to pay between £25.00 and £45.00 per square meter for professional services.

The overall cost may change depending on multiple factors.

The final cost factors in the size of the area, the condition of the Travertine, and the complexity of the tasks involved.

Should your Travertine show stains, cracks, or missing grout, the price could go up.

The initial step in the cleaning process is inspecting your travertine floors to ensure you receive the most accurate estimate.

Our inspection will include looking for holes, cracks, and areas lacking grout.

This meticulous inspection provides insight into the needs of your floors.

Discover the Secret to Perfect Floors with Travertine Cleaning

Travertine floor cleaning and restoration breathes new life into your surfaces, making them look pristine.

We use high-quality cleaners and powerful scrubbers to remove all sealer residue and surface dirt.

We work with hot-water pressure rinsing to wash away surface slurry after scrubbing.

Any cracks, holes, or gaps in your travertine will be filled with the proper resin or cement filler.

It's recommended to book travertine cleaning every six to twelve months, based on the amount of foot traffic and how the surface is used. A good cleaning routine will keep your travertine beautiful and durable, allowing you to relax in your home.

Cleaning travertine with household products is possible, but you need to be careful. Avoid acidic cleaners like vinegar, as they can damage the stone. Stick to pH-neutral solutions, and always test a small area first for safety.

Without doubt, travertine's toughness and weather-resistant qualities make it ideal for outdoor usage. It delivers a stunning look while enduring diverse elements, enabling you to appreciate your outdoor environments without fretting about damage.

The travertine cleaning process typically takes a day or two, depending on the area's size and condition. Immediate changes are visible, though it's advisable to allow enough time for the sealer to cure fully following the process.
